NVIDIA’s Blackwell Ultra GB300 AI servers are expected to be the company’s dominant offering for hyperscalers next year, and as a result, shipments are projected to rise significantly. NVIDIA’s GB300 AI Servers Have Seen Significantly Improved Production Yield Rates, Following Design Changes NVIDIA has been operating under an annual product cadence, and this year, we saw the debut of Blackwell Ultra in Q2 2025 at the GTC keynote. However, volume ramp-up took place in the middle of Q3 and Q4, which meant that this year, hyperscalers were aggressively adopting the Blackwell GB200 server configurations.
